Finding Every Deal, Effortlessly at SM North

Navigating SM North EDSA’s “Great Northern Sale” is now easier with Duon Wayfinding.

For many shoppers, the thrill of a major sale often comes with an unexpected challenge—navigating the vast spaces of a destination as expansive as SM North EDSA. During the much-anticipated Great Northern Sale, where hundreds of retailers are offering discounts of up to 70 percent, excitement can easily turn into fatigue without the right guide. This season, however, the journey through the mall takes on a smarter direction as SM North EDSA partners with Duon Wayfinding, the country’s first real-time indoor navigation platform, to transform the shopping experience into something seamless, efficient, and genuinely enjoyable.

Through the Duon Wayfinding app, visitors can instantly locate participating stores, receive precise turn-by-turn directions, and even map out their shopping routes before arriving. What once required long walks, repeated inquiries, and valuable time is now simplified into a few taps on a mobile screen—allowing shoppers to focus less on searching and more on discovering meaningful deals. The innovation reflects SM Supermalls’ continued commitment to elevating convenience, ensuring that every moment inside the mall feels purposeful and rewarding.

Participating merchants in the “Great Northern Sale” are highlighted in the Duon Wayfinding app.

According to SM Supermalls Executive Vice President for Marketing Joaquin San Agustin, the evolution of the Great Northern Sale goes beyond price reductions. This year’s focus centers on creating a fully optimized experience designed around the needs of today’s fast-moving, digitally connected customers. By integrating real-time navigation into the event, SM North EDSA turns value into something more personal—time saved, stress reduced, and celebrations extended.

The convenience does not end once the final purchase is made. Whether shoppers are heading toward a cozy Valentine’s dinner or gathering with loved ones for a festive Chinese New Year meal, the same navigation technology smoothly guides them to their next destination. In this way, the partnership with Duon Wayfinding becomes more than a digital feature; it becomes a quiet companion to moments of joy shared beyond the shopping floor.

Dining destinations at SM North EDSA that are perfect for the upcoming Valentine’s Day and Chinese New Year celebrations are easier to navigate with Duon Wayfinding.

As the Great Northern Sale continues until February 15, guests are encouraged to download the Duon Wayfinding app from the App Store or Google Play before arriving—unlocking a five-day retail adventure where every deal, and every celebration, is easier to find.
